The great Piedmontese honey festival in the heart of the Turin hills
The Marentino Regional Honey Fair is one of the longest-running and most renowned food and wine events in the Turin hills. Every year, in late September, the historic center of Marentinoโa town in the Province of Turin, Piedmontโtransforms into a grand showcase dedicated to the 'sweet gold' of bees. The fair reached its thirtieth edition in 2025 and continues in 2026 with its thirty-first, cementing its status as a staple of the regional beekeeping calendar.
The heart of the event is the market exhibition that winds through the town's streets. Beekeepers are selected in close collaboration with Beekeeping Associations, which oversee honey quality control and fair pricing: every year, about sixteen producers from across the Piedmont region are invited. Alongside sales, the fair dedicates significant space to education: guided honey tastings, educational workshops on beekeeping, and meetings on biodiversity and the role of bees in the environment. It is an opportunity to discover the work of beekeepers and the importance of protecting pollinators up close.
The event complements its commercial side with a rich array of activities. Traditional highlights include the Honey Concert, featuring local marching bands, while the naturalistic aspect is expressed through walks to the nearby Lake Arignano and visits to the experimental apiary. There is no shortage of activities designed for children and families, making the fair a perfect day to spend outdoors amidst hills, flavors, and tradition.
During the fair, it is possible to have lunch thanks to the Pro Loco stand and special menus offered by local restaurants, which highlight the dishes of Piedmontese cuisine. A delicious stop that completes the visit and tells the story of the deep bond between Marentino, its hilly landscape, and the culture of honey.
The Municipality of Marentino has confirmed on its official website the 31st edition of the Honey Fair, scheduled for Sunday, September 27, 2026, with the usual opening initiatives on Saturday. As per tradition, the market exhibition will bring together beekeepers selected by trade associations, offering monofloral and wildflower honeys, propolis, and typical Piedmontese products. The detailed 2026 program (times, concert, workshops, and activities) will be published by the organization in the weeks leading up to the event.
Marentino is located in the Turin hills, about 25 km east of Turin. By car, it can be reached from the Turin Tangenziale (ring road) towards Chieri, then continuing towards Arignano and Marentino. Those arriving by train can get off at the Chieri station and continue by local transport or by car.
The event typically takes place on the last weekend of September. The 2026 edition is scheduled for Sunday, September 27, with opening events on Saturday.
Admission to the fair is free.
